Wierd problem with Alpine IVA W205 install

Wanted to see if you guys might possibly be able to help out. Just installed this with the TR-7 and PAC JACK. Below is what occurs currently.

- Turn car to ON position, everything works fine.
- From that point, proceed to start vehicle, Alpine does not work. Blank screen, and after 15 or so seconds, the screen comes back, but no functionality.
- What could possibly be the issue here?

2nd Scenerio......

- From OFF position, proceed to fully start the car, without pausing at the, "ON" position, and everything works fine.
- Is this because of the TR-7 or another cause?

Cliffs: If I stop at the ON position, hu works, if I start the car from there, it stops working. If I don't stop at the ON position, and I just start the car from the OFF position, it works fine.

Any ideas, and where's this how-to that everyone keeps talking about for the PAC-JACK install. I can't get it to take any of the steering wheel programming functions. I'd like to see a diagram of the install if anyone has one. Searched but, there was no luck in finding my answer for this.

its the tr7 thats causing your problems...take it out and just wire up a bypass to the hand brake

the one that goes to the hand brake you can send it to a pulse switch and ground it...works the same way as the tr7 but you just have to click it on/off each time you want to bypass the system

The TR7 has a programable delay of up to 4 minutes and 15 seconds before turning off/on... You should look into how to remove the delay
